Abstract

N,N′-Bis(2-aminophenyl)-1,2-ethanediamine is synthesized from 1,2-diaminoethane and 1-chloro-2-nitrobenzene in the presence of sodium carbonate and the product reduced by zinc dust and ammonium chloride. A novel stable dication is synthesized by reaction of N,N′-bis(2-aminophenyl)-1,2-ethanediamine and 2-pyridinecarboxaldehyde in the presence of manganese chloride in methanol. The X-ray structural analysis shows formation of the dication. © 2008 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
